Detailed Overview and About (BA in Sociology from Asian International University)

 

The BA in Sociology program at Asian International University aims to provide students with a comprehensive understanding of the social world and the various social, cultural, and political issues that shape our lives. Through this program, students will develop the critical thinking and analytical skills necessary to examine social issues and propose solutions to problems that affect communities and societies. The program covers a range of subjects including social theory, research methods, globalization, social inequality, gender and sexuality, and environmental issues, among others.

 

Students who complete this program will be equipped with the knowledge and skills necessary to pursue careers in a variety of fields, including education, social work, policy-making, community development, and research, among others. The program is designed to provide students with a broad foundation in sociology while also allowing them to specialize in areas of their choice through a range of elective courses.

 

Overall, the BA in Sociology program at Asian International University aims to produce graduates who are well-rounded, socially engaged, and equipped to make a positive impact in their communities and the wider world.

Eligibility (BA in Sociology from Asian International University)

 

The eligibility criteria for BA in Sociology from Asian International University are as follows:

 

  • Candidates must have completed their higher secondary education (10+2) or equivalent in any stream from a recognized board.

  • There is no age limit for admission to this course.

  • Some universities may require a minimum aggregate percentage in the qualifying examination for admission.

Highlights (BA in Sociology from Asian International University):

 

Full name of the University

Asian International University

Full name of the course

Bachelor of Arts (BA) in Sociology

Duration of the course

Three years

Established on

2021

Language Required

Hindi/English

Admission Sessions

June/July

Type of the Institute

Private University

Eligibility Criteria

Candidates must have completed 10+2 or equivalent examination from a recognized board.

Fee Required for the course

INR 1 lakh to 5 lakh

Job roles

Social Worker, Community Outreach Coordinator, Human Resources Specialist, Market Research Analyst¸ Policy Analyst, etc.

College Location

Imphal, Manipur

University Website

https://aiu.edu.in/

   
   




Admission Process (BA in Sociology) Asian International University

 

The admission process for the BA in Sociology program at Asian International University typically involves the following steps:

 

  • Application: Interested candidates need to submit an application form, which can be obtained from the university's admission office or downloaded from the official website.

 

  • Eligibility Check: The university will screen the applications to ensure that the candidates meet the eligibility criteria for the program.

 

  • Entrance Exam: Candidates may be required to take an entrance exam, which will test their knowledge of subjects such as sociology, history, economics, and political science.

 

  • Personal Interview: Shortlisted candidates will be invited for a personal interview with a panel of faculty members. This is an opportunity for the university to assess the candidate's personality, communication skills, and interest in the program.

 

  • Final Selection: The university will make the final selection based on the candidate's performance in the entrance exam, personal interview, and academic record.

 

It is important to note that the admission process may vary slightly depending on the university's policies and procedures. It is recommended that candidates check the official website or contact the admission office for more information.



Syllabus to be Study in the duration of the course BA in Sociology from Asian International University:

 

The syllabus for BA in Sociology from Asian International University may vary depending on the institution, but some of the common topics that are usually covered in this course are:

 

  • Introduction to Sociology

  • Sociological Theories

  • Sociological Research Methodology

  • Social Stratification and Inequality

  • Social Change and Social Movements

  • Gender Studies

  • Rural and Urban Sociology

  • Environmental Sociology

  • Sociology of Education

  • Sociology of Health and Medicine

  • Sociology of Law

  • Sociology of Mass Communication

  • Political Sociology

  • Industrial Sociology

  • Sociology of Religion

 

Additionally, students may also be required to complete a research project or dissertation in their final year, which involves applying sociological concepts and theories to a real-world issue or problem.

Frequently Asked Questions:

 

Question: What is the difference between BA in Sociology and BA in Social Work?

 

Answer: BA in Sociology is a study of human behavior, social structures, and social institutions, while BA in Social Work focuses on understanding the needs of people and communities and addressing social issues.

 

Question: What are the career opportunities after completing BA in Sociology?

 

Answer: Graduates of BA in Sociology can pursue various career opportunities such as social researcher, social worker, human resources, community organizer, counselor, and policy analyst.

 

Question: Is a master's degree necessary to find a job in the field of sociology?

 

Answer: While a master's degree may provide more job opportunities and higher pay, a BA in Sociology can lead to entry-level positions in various fields related to sociology.

 

Question: What are the skills required to excel in the field of sociology?

 

Answer: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, analytical and critical thinking abilities, research and data analysis skills, and a broad understanding of social, political, and cultural issues are essential skills to excel in the field of sociology.





Question: Can sociology majors work in the private sector?

 

Answer: Yes, sociology majors can work in the private sector, particularly in the fields of marketing, public relations, human resources, and consulting. Employers in these industries value sociology majors' understanding of human behavior and society.
